Travel Score in 11951, Mastic Beach, New York

The Travel Score for the Lung Cancer Score in 11951, Mastic Beach, New York is 58 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

38.93 percent of residents in 11951 to travel to work in 30 minutes or less.

When looking at the three closest hospitals, the average distance to a hospital is 12.18 miles. The closest hospital with an emergency room is Peconic Bay Medical Center with a distance of 14.05 miles from the area.

## Lung Cancer Score: Navigating Healthcare in Mastic Beach (ZIP Code 11951)

The salty air and serene beaches of Mastic Beach, New York (ZIP code 11951), offer a compelling allure for those seeking a coastal lifestyle. However, prospective residents must consider a crucial factor: **healthcare access**, particularly for a disease as serious as lung cancer. This write-up assesses the **transportation** landscape, crucial for timely diagnosis and treatment, to create a "Lung Cancer Score" for this community. This score will reflect the ease or difficulty of accessing specialized medical care, a vital consideration for anyone **moving to Mastic Beach**.

The journey to healthcare in this Suffolk County enclave is primarily dictated by the limitations of Long Island's **transportation** infrastructure. The primary arteries are the William Floyd Parkway and Montauk Highway (NY-27A), both of which can become congested, especially during peak commuting hours. The Long Island Rail Road (LIRR) provides a vital alternative, but its reach and frequency are limited, and its connection to specialized cancer centers requires further **transportation**.

For individuals in Mastic Beach, the nearest hospitals with comprehensive cancer care are a significant drive away. The drive to Stony Brook University Hospital, a major regional medical center, typically takes between 30 to 45 minutes, depending on traffic conditions on the William Floyd Parkway and Nicolls Road. This time can easily double during rush hour. Good Samaritan Hospital Medical Center in West Islip is another option, reachable via Montauk Highway and the Southern State Parkway, a journey of approximately 45 minutes to an hour, again, contingent on traffic.

Public **transportation** options are available, but they present challenges. The Suffolk County Transit (SCT) system offers bus routes that serve Mastic Beach. Route 80 connects to the LIRR station in Mastic-Shirley, providing a link to the wider rail network. From there, passengers can travel west towards Stony Brook or east towards other medical facilities. However, bus schedules are infrequent, especially on weekends and evenings, and the routes are not always direct. Accessibility for individuals with mobility limitations is also a concern. While SCT buses are equipped with ADA-compliant features, navigating transfers and waiting for connections can be arduous for patients undergoing treatment.

The LIRR itself offers a more efficient, albeit less frequent, option. The Mastic-Shirley station is a key hub. From here, commuters can travel to Penn Station in Manhattan, which provides access to a wider range of cancer centers, including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center and New York-Presbyterian Hospital. However, this journey involves a significant time commitment, often exceeding two hours each way, including travel to the station, the train ride, and the final leg of **transportation** in Manhattan. This extended travel time can be particularly challenging for patients experiencing fatigue or undergoing chemotherapy.

Ride-sharing services, such as Uber and Lyft, offer a more flexible **transportation** alternative. However, availability can be inconsistent, especially during off-peak hours or in inclement weather. The cost of these services can also be a significant financial burden for patients and their families, especially considering the frequency of appointments and treatments. Furthermore, the availability of specialized medical **transportation** services, designed to accommodate patients with specific needs, is limited in the Mastic Beach area.

Medical **transportation** companies, such as CareRide and Logisticare, may provide non-emergency medical **transportation** services, but their availability and coverage area should be confirmed. These services often require prior authorization and may have specific eligibility criteria. Investigating these options is crucial for patients who may require assistance with **transportation** due to their medical condition.
